The Demon Inside

Doors slam shut on their own.  Dark figures lurk in the shadows.  Unnatural images in the mirror.  This is a movie, quite literally, about all the haunted skeletons in one man’s closet and, as it takes its time with the build-up, makes for a HELL of a ride through the darkest night of the soul.

Because these skeletons ALL come to life with The Demon Inside!

What begins as a possible home invasion movie ends in a supernatural bloodbath as one couple, Sam (Joseph Rene) and Courtney Parsons (Madeline Thelton), try to outrun AND survive the haunted past.  It’s all in an effort to protect their daughter, Harper (Chloe Lee), whose cuteness threatens to steal the movie away from Rene time and time again, as she is put in some pretty scary situations involving a monster under the bed.

You see, Sam is on a very tight leash in his personal life.  He’s an ex-con and everybody knows it.  His boss is a jerk and sometimes, Courtney, is as well.  Maybe they both want what is best for Sam, but it’s hard to tell as his boss is a constant thorn and Sam’s relationship with Courtney seems to be on the rocks.  There’s definitely tension there.

But when it comes to the rising occult action in the house, it’s all about protecting Harper, right?  So, when their home’s security system goes off in the middle of the night, it’s all hands on deck and the heightened sense of alarm doesn’t ever fade because this demon is JUST GETTING STARTED.The Demon Inside

Has Sam’s past caught up with him?  If only.  The Demon Inside, while stressing the past, concerns itself with a demonic possession inside the house.  Something WILD is going on, but whatever Sam and Courtney do to try to quell the growing demon only makes it stronger.

From Writer/Director Joey Moran, The Demon Inside might not be thought-provoking but it is INTENSE as its spills and chills are built solidly with long takes throughout the 100-minute movie and the nice use of tall, tall shadows.  Maybe this film is a bit too long, but it certainly works if you throw logic out the window and have fun with its independent vibes.  

From beginning to end, Moran builds suspense with a growing sense of dread for this couple.  And then, when all else fails, Sam and Courtney turn to a hilarious team of ghost hunters.  It doesn’t help matters.  With this group of characters, Moran eases up the tension as this ghost hunting team hearkens all too often to a VERY PUBLIC team and, thankfully, pokes fun at the world of paranormal, reality-based entertainment programs and their massive (but easily bruised) egos.   

The Demon Insid , filmed in Dallas and produced by Timothy Talbott (who also has a fun role in the movie) is now playing on Amazon Prime.

3/5 stars

Synopsis: Years after his release from jail, Sam Parsons is trying to rebuild his life with his wife Courtney and their young daughter Harper. He works hard to provide for his family and afford their beautiful home in their quiet suburban neighborhood. When supernatural occurrences start to happen in the house, Sam fears for the safety of his wife and daughter. When the occurrences turn into attacks, Sam hires Corbin Carlysle and his reality TV show ghost hunting team known as "The Ghost Killers", to help him battle the dark entity that's lurking in the shadows of his home.
